Looking up portsnap.FreeBSD.org mirrors... none found.

andrew clarke mail at ozzmosis.com
Mon Apr 21 21:40:44 UTC 2008

I have serveral FreeBSD machines on my home network and was wondering
why Portsnap failed to find any mirrors on some but not others.  I had
a look at the /usr/sbin/portsnap script to find out what it is doing.
The command it calls to search for mirrors is:

host -t srv _http._tcp.portsnap.freebsd.org

resulting in:

;; connection timed out; no servers could be reached

After a bit of investigating it turns out that on the machines where
it failed, /etc/resolv.conf was configured to use my D-Link DSL-504T
ADSL modem/router's internal nameserver for DNS lookups.  Changing
resolv.conf to instead point directly at my ISP's nameservers solved
the problem.

